RBH launches talent development programme for 2024

RBH has a portfolio of more than 50 hotels operating across the hotel chain scale from economy through to upper upscale and luxury

RBH Hospitality Management has announced the launch of its Pyramid Programme for 2024.

The development programme is designed to give ambitious heads of departments within the RBH portfolio of over 50 hotels an opportunity to fast-track into senior roles with the right training.

Now in its sixth year, the scheme has already seen five previous candidates become general managers, while 46% of its delegates have been promoted into deputy manager roles, and 29% have had the confidence to move into larger roles.

RBH’s 2022 intake of 12 candidates concluded with a series of promotions including Stacey Lucas, now operations manager at The Olde Bell, previously guest services manager at ibis Heathrow T5.

Over the next 12 months, the 2023 cohort of 13 employees who successfully completed the thorough assessment process will now participate in a series of hotel management masterclasses.

Niki Fincham, group learning and development manager at RBH, said: “This programme continues to prove the return on investment when it comes to in-depth training opportunities for our teams. I am so proud of the measurable success our candidates have had and I feel these types of opportunities that offer such practical learnings are one of the reasons our employee retention rates remain so positive.”

Lucas added: “I can’t speak highly enough of the Pyramid Programme and the fast-track career opportunities it offers. It has undoubtedly broadened my skills and knowledge to make me a more confident hotelier, leading to my promotion into a deputy general manager role sooner than expected.”
